Do You Have a Cracked Tooth?

A cracked tooth can cause pain when chewing, pressure when biting, or sensitivity to hot and cold. The pain may come and go, making it hard to pinpoint the problem. When you chew, the crack can open and close, irritating the pulp inside and causing sharp discomfort. If left untreated, the pulp can become damaged or infected, which may spread to the gums or bone. Prompt treatment at our practice can save your tooth and prevent bigger issues.

A Tooth That Feels Loose?

Sometimes an injury pushes a tooth out of place. If it is partially out of the socket, the tooth and roots are at risk for infection or even tooth loss. In many cases, your endodontist can reposition the tooth. If the pulp remains healthy, no further care is needed, but a root canal may be required if it is damaged. If a tooth is pushed deeper into the socket, our team can provide root canal therapy to restore it, giving the tooth the best chance to be saved.

Have a Knocked-Out Tooth?

If a tooth is completely knocked out, act quickly. Stay calm and try to gently place it back in the socket. If you cannot, keep the tooth in a small container of milk or in water with a pinch of salt. Bring it to the dentist immediately. The faster you get help, the better the chances of saving the tooth. Depending on how long the tooth has been out and its stage of root development, Dr. Grey will recommend the best treatment.
